Understanding the Magic of Opal Stone Rings

Opals are renowned for their unique phenomenon known as ‘play-of-color,’ a dazzling display of shifting hues that dance across the gem’s surface when viewed from different angles. This mesmerising effect is caused by the diffraction of light through the microscopic silica spheres that make up the opal. No two opals are exactly alike, ensuring that every opal stone ring is a one-of-a-kind masterpiece. This inherent uniqueness is a significant part of their allure, appealing to individuals who seek distinctive adornments. The spectral display can range from vibrant fire to subtle pastels, creating a captivating visual experience.

The Geological Journey of Opal

Opals are formed when silica-rich water seeps into the cracks and cavities of other rocks, typically sedimentary rocks. Over vast periods, this water evaporates, leaving behind a deposit of hydrated silica. The precise arrangement of these microscopic spheres dictates the intensity and pattern of the play-of-color. The most famous opals, particularly the precious opals, are found in specific geological locations worldwide. The value and desirability of an opal stone ring often depend on the rarity and quality of the opal used, with Australian opals, especially those from Coober Pedy, being among the most prized for their vibrant colors and stable nature.

Types of Opals for Rings

The world of opals is diverse, offering a spectrum of choices for an opal stone ring:

  • Precious Opal: This is the most sought-after type, displaying the characteristic play-of-color. It includes varieties like Black Opal (rare and valuable with a dark body tone), White Opal (common, with a lighter background), and Boulder Opal (where the opal is found attached to the host rock).
  • Fire Opal: Known for its translucent to opaque orange, red, or yellow body color, sometimes with play-of-color.
  • Common Opal (Potch): This variety lacks the play-of-color and is usually opaque, often used for decorative purposes but less common in fine jewelry like an opal stone ring.

When selecting an opal stone ring, understanding these distinctions helps in appreciating the gem’s value and unique characteristics. The vibrant blues, greens, reds, and oranges create a stunning visual appeal that is hard to match, making each opal stone ring a statement piece.

Opal as a Birthstone

Opal is the traditional and modern birthstone for October. For individuals born in this month, an opal stone ring serves as a deeply personal and significant piece of jewelry, celebrating their birth month with a gemstone that is as unique and vibrant as they are. The association with autumn connects the opal’s warm tones and fiery flashes to the season’s changing colors. It is also often associated with the astrological signs of Cancer, Libra, and Scorpio, believed to enhance intuition, balance, and inner strength for these signs. Cultural Significance

In ancient Rome, opals were considered a symbol of love and hope. Arab legends tell of opals falling from the sky during thunderstorms. In contrast, some European folklore associated opals with bad luck, particularly when given as a gift, though this superstition has largely faded with the appreciation for their beauty and the rise of ethically sourced gems. Today, the emphasis is on the gem’s natural wonder and its connection to creativity and inspiration. Key Factors to Consider

  1. Opal Quality: Look for a strong, vibrant play-of-color that covers a significant portion of the opal’s surface. The intensity, pattern, and range of colors are crucial. A darker body tone (as in black opal) often makes the colors appear more vibrant, but a lively white opal can be equally stunning.
  2. Body Tone: This refers to the background color of the opal. Gemologists classify opals from ‘Black’ (darkest, most valuable) to ‘White’ or ‘Light’ (palest). The body tone significantly influences how the play-of-color is perceived.
  3. Cut and Shape: Opals are most commonly cut into cabochon (smooth, domed) shapes to best display their color. The shape of the opal should complement the ring design.
  4. Setting: The metal setting (e.g., gold, silver, platinum) should enhance the opal’s beauty and protect it. Opals are relatively soft compared to diamonds, so protective settings like bezels are often recommended for an opal stone ring to prevent chipping or scratching.
  5. Origin and Authenticity: Knowing the origin of the opal (e.g., Australia, Ethiopia, Mexico) can add to its story and value. Ensure you are purchasing from a reputable dealer, especially when buying an opal stone ring in a location like Annapolis.

Caring for Your Opal Stone Ring

Opals are beautiful but delicate gemstones, requiring specific care to maintain their luster and prevent damage. Understanding how to properly care for your opal stone ring will ensure it remains a treasured piece for a lifetime. The key is to avoid conditions that can compromise the gem’s integrity or cause it to lose its characteristic moisture, which can lead to crazing (fine cracks).

Do’s and Don’ts for Opal Care

  • DO: Clean your opal stone ring gently with a soft, damp cloth. Use mild soap and water only if necessary, and ensure the opal is thoroughly dried.
  • DON’T: Expose your opal to harsh chemicals, including household cleaners, perfumes, and cosmetics. These can damage the surface or cause the play-of-color to fade.
  • DO: Store your opal stone ring separately from other jewelry to prevent scratches. A soft pouch or a divided jewelry box is ideal.
  • DON’T: Subject your opal to sudden temperature changes or prolonged exposure to direct sunlight, as this can cause dehydration and cracking. Avoid wearing your opal stone ring during strenuous activities, swimming, or showering.
  • DO: Ensure your opal is properly set. A bezel setting offers more protection than a prong setting for opals.

By following these simple care guidelines, you can preserve the beauty and vibrancy of your opal stone ring, ensuring it remains a stunning accessory for years to come. Frequently Asked Questions About Opal Stone Rings

Are opal stone rings durable enough for daily wear in Annapolis?

While opals are beautiful, they are softer than many other gemstones and can be prone to scratching or chipping. For daily wear in a city like Annapolis, it’s recommended to opt for a more protective setting, such as a bezel, and to remove your opal stone ring during strenuous activities or when exposed to harsh chemicals to ensure its longevity.

What is the average price range for an opal stone ring in the United States?

The price of an opal stone ring in the United States can vary widely, from a few hundred dollars for smaller white opals in simple settings to thousands or even tens of thousands for rare black opals with exceptional fire and color, often set in precious metals like gold. How can I tell if an opal is real or synthetic?

Genuine opals will exhibit a natural play-of-color that shifts with light and angle. Synthetic opals might have a more uniform or intense color display. Reputable jewelers in Annapolis and across the United States will always disclose whether a stone is natural or synthetic. Look for consistent patterns and a natural “skin” on solid opals.
